Various types of standard circuits in different sizes and power are available. (Seated height 5.08mm, 6.5mm, 10.7mm Max.)
・
For automatic insertion machines, stick magazines (the tip of lead terminal is cut to a V shape) and taping packages (TBA: All leads taping, TPA, TUA:3 leads
taping) are applicable.
・
Products with lead free termination meet EU-RoHS requirements. EU-RoHS regulation is not intended for Pb-glass contained in electrode, resistor element and
glass.

For resistors operated at an ambient temperature of 70℃ or higher, the power shall be derated in accordance with the above derating curve.
■Precautions for Use
・The
conditions of flow soldering for lead-free terminal resistors are set up at 260℃ max. within 10 sec.
・A
few cross talks will happen in network resistors. Design the circuit taking the effect by the cross talks into consideration as very low voltage will occur to the
resistor elements that don’t pass current by the voltage drop in common electrode if current flows to the common electrodes.
